Transaction 2860dd4bdc5e31ad54da2ba4e3646a880774c27bbdd5de9d4b96ea238638b1ba

3 Input
2 Outputs
  • 2860dd4bdc5e31ad54da2ba4e3646a880774c27bbdd5de9d4b96ea238638b1ba:0
  • value  3958696
    address  3Mcg2eCsvs4McYPecGbAzubynsv72shybX
  • 2860dd4bdc5e31ad54da2ba4e3646a880774c27bbdd5de9d4b96ea238638b1ba:1
  • value  1488386
    address  1G5LmF8wUQkdDpCv8Tmcp1aJZ6Ki4YWzgA